I’m from Germany and need help with LimeSurvey for my thesis. I created a survey in the LimeSurvey-Version of my university (1.92+ Build 120919). There are 13 question groups which should be presented randomized to the participants with certain conditions. For that I can’t use the Expressionmanager, because it’s not available in the version of my university.
There are the groups A, B, C, D, E, F, G, H, I, J, K, L and M and the conditions are these:

1. Group A has to be always at the first place.
2. Groups E and F have to appear one after another and connected.
3. Groups K, L and M have to appear in this order and always at the end of the survey.

It would be okay as well, if there was the possibility to create one link for multiple surveys, so I could design like 4 surveys with different orders and spread the participants to this 4 versions via one link.

I would be very grateful for a step-by-step instruction of how to do this, since I don’t have any LimeSurvey know-how.

I don't think you can do that. Even with Expression Manager you wouldn't be able to randomize B through J but always keep E and F together.
